Things to do in Nyack?Living in Nyack, NY is a great experience. The small village situated on the Hudson River is filled with character and charm that captivates its residents and visitors alike. One can find plenty of opportunities to explore nature, from the miles of hiking trails in Hook Mountain State Park to kayaking down the river. The downtown area has a variety of unique shops, restaurants and coffee houses for anyone looking for something different. With its close proximity to New York City and the rest of the tri-state area, visitors can easily access all the attractions this bustling metropolitan area has to offer.
Things to do in Montclair?Montclair, New Jersey is situated in Essex county providing visitors leisure areas such as Eagle Rock Reservation while also having employment opportunities at Mountainside Hospital along with entertainment opportunities at Wellmont Theatre.
